Ethereum: How is mining the exact same hash on every computer avoided?

Ethereum: How does a mining consensus act and prevents duplicate seeds

In Ethereum, mining is a procedure for confirming transactions and adding their blockchain. In order to ensure the integrity and safety of the network, the consensitive algorithm must be established to confirm these transactions without any node or computer that control the entire procedure. One of the key challenges in achieving this consensus is the use of hash functions used to create a unique digital fingerprint for each block transactions.

How does the consensus Ethereum work?

In Ethereum, the consensus algorithm is called the proof of work (POW). This means that the miners compete for solving complex mathematical puzzles, which requires significant computer power. The first miner to deal with the puzzle must confirm the transactions and create a new block. The new block is added to Blockchain, which is then broadcast to all other nodes online.

How does a mining consensus prevents duplicate seeds?

The main question in achieving a consensus without any only node or computer that controls the whole procedure is that the miners ensure that the seeds (or hashes) are not the same for each block transaction. Here’s how:

  • HASH functions

    : Each block has a unique hash function, which is used to create a digital fingerprint of the block. The hash function takes the content of the block as an entrance and comes out a string of fixed size signs, known as “Block Hash”.

  • Seed Generation : To create seeds, miners use more random numbers (known as “nonce”) and combine them with a block hash. This procedure is repeated repeatedly until unique seed is generated.

  • Block hash and semen combination : When creating a new block, the miner combines the content of the block (including the hash previous block) with the previously generated seed. The resulting combination is known as the “block hash”.

  • Proof of work : In order to create a block hash, miners must solve a complex mathematical puzzle. This puzzle requires significant computer power and is designed so that malicious actors are difficult to exploit.

  • Difficulty adjusting : As more miners join the network, the level of difficulty in resolving the puzzle increases. The difficulty adjusting mechanism ensures that the puzzle remains challenging, but it is not impossible to solve.

How do mining clients provide a unique seed?

In order to ensure that unique seeds are generated on each mining equipment, minerships use a combination of techniques:

  • A random generation number : Each miner uses more random numbers (not) to generate its seed.

  • Hashing seeds : Rudar combines without a block hash block and repeats this procedure several times until a unique seed is generated.

  • HASH function : The resulting seed is then cried using a cryptographic hash function (such as a SHA-256 or ECDSA) to ensure its uniqueness.

additional measures

To further prevent the duplicate of the seeds, Ethereum implemented additional measures:

  • Mining Association : The miners together unite their resources to increase the likelihood of finding a unique solution for the puzzle.

  • Block Time and Difficulty : The Time of the Block (the time that the miner needs to solve the puzzle) increases that more miners join the network, which makes it difficult to exploit the system using a rough force.

  • Energy requirements : Energy requirements for solving the puzzle are high, which reduces the incentive to malicious actors to try to use the system.

Conclusion

In conclusion, the Ethereum consensus algorithm, proof of work (POW), requires miners to use complex mathematical puzzles to confirm transactions and create new blocks. To prevent duplicate seeds, miner clients use a combination of creating random numbers, scattering seeds and hash functions to ensure uniqueness.

Ethereum Purpose Op_drop

Add a Comment

Your email address will not be published.

0 tour
United Kingdom
Travel to

United Kingdom

Quick booking process

Talk to an expert

+91 98392 24658

Lorem ipsum dolor sit amet, consectetur adipiscing elit. Ut elit tellus, luctus nec ullamcorper mattis, pulvinar dapibus leo.

HOBOLER TRAVELS & RESORTS